SUWANEE - Greater Atlanta Christian improved to 11-3 with a pair of wins over Chattahoochee (25-15, 25-20) and Central Gwinnett (25-17, 19-25, 25-9) Tuesday night at Peachtree Ridge High School. The Spartans were led on defense by D'Nay Daniels with 10 kills and Ashley Agin with nine kills. Jennifer Godleski added 12 digs and Christie Howard led the team in assists with 33.
Central improved its record to 7-5 by defeating Peachtree Ridge 25-8, 25-16. Karen Green amassed nine kills, three blocks and three assists for the Black Knights while teammate Amber Kirkpatrick had four kills and three blocks. Peachtree Ridge ended its night with a 26-28, 25-19, 25-14 defeat over Chattahoochee. Amanda Kerr had seven kills and six aces for the Lions while Jasmine Johnson had five kills. Lindsey Ajala finished with four kills and four blocks while Sarah Bernard and Nicole Louchard had nine and four assists, respectively. VOLLEYBALL Brookwood defeats Norcross, Mill Creek SNELLVILLE - Brookwood's Leah Kitchen led the Broncos with 27 assists as the Broncos swept past Norcross (25-8, 25-17) and Mill Creek (25-18, 19-25, 25-23) Tuesday. Shannon Parry had eight aces for the Broncos (10-3) and Paige Ivey compiled 16 kills and 12 digs. Mill Creek salvaged a split with a 25-9, 25-10 sweep over Norcross. Emily Clayton led the Hawks (11-4) with 34 digs while Dominique Jackson had 17 kills. Parkview beats Sprayberry CANTON - Parkview defeated Sprayberry on Tuesday night (25-19, 25-12) but fell to fifth-ranked Sequoyah (15-25, 21-25). Parkview was led by Jessica Geiger with three blocks, 23 kills and five digs while Maggie Dean had four blocks, eight kills and five digs. Regina Lewis led the team with 12 assists and two blocks while Marissa Hicks had six kills and three digs. The win improves Parkview's record to 9-3 on the year. Hebron downs South, Winder-Barrow DACULA - Hebron evened its record at 7-7 Tuesday night with a pair of wins over South Gwinnett (25-21, 20-25, 25-19) and Winder-Barrow (22-25, 25-12, 25-19). Amy Herald had 21 kills for the Lions, Madelyn Hosch added four kills and two aces while Whitney Smith served four aces. South was led by offensively by Jenny Hester with six assists, Nellya Zaystev with 23 assists and four blocks and Amy McEachin added five blocks defensively. South Gwinnett earned a split on the night by defeating Winder Barrow (25-17, 20-25, 25-19). Jenny Hester and Nellya Zaystev both had five aces. Nellya also had 18 assists while Amy McEachin had 10. Killian Hill sweeps Forest Hills LILBURN - The Killian Hill volleyball team swept past Forest Hills on Tuesday by the scores of 25-14, 26-24, 25-7. Allyson Trine had 17 kills and 15 assists, Lauren McMahan had eight aces and seven kills and Catherine Petersen had five aces and four kills. Killian Hill is now 3-0 on the season. SOFTBALL Hebron 8, Social Circle 0 SOCIAL CIRCLE - Nichole Smith pitched a two-hitter on Tuesday as Hebron Christian defeated Social Circle 8-0 in Region 8-A action.
